Greetings dakka folk,
Am currently working on an Imperial Fists force, and my next paint project is the thunderfire cannon and accompanying techmarine. Now, from what i have seen of techmarines in the SM codex, most people decide to paint these a dark red, but there are also some Ultramarine techs, who are painted in the normal Ultramarine scheme. I have always taken it for granted that their armour should be red, but now i am confused. I checked lexicanum, but the techmarine entry does not describe the armour that they wear. Can anyone in their wisdom, kindly enlighten me?

Some wear red with the shoulder pad painted with the chapter colours and symbol.
Others wear the chapter colours with the shoulder pad painted red.
It varies...

Yeah, fluff wise people painted them red to show their connection with admech, librarians used to be blue, and chaplins used to be black. Used to be a universal thing but now it seems to be up too the player

Putting it bluntly, Nathaniel--it's up to you.
You can do them in the standard Imperial Fists color with their helmet, shoulderpads, and greaves done in red--or do them in all red with the blank left shoulderpad done in IF yellow.
I'm doing my Techmarines for my DA Successor overall in the Chapter colors(a dark grey), but with a red right hand shoulderpad, red helm, and the servo-harness done up in red as well.
